Madison is a charming and historic town located in Morris County, New Jersey. It is known for its picturesque downtown area, beautiful parks, and rich history. With a population of approximately 16,000 people, Madison offers a small-town feel while still providing access to all the amenities and conveniences of a larger city.

One of the most striking features of Madison is its downtown area, which is filled with unique shops, boutiques, and restaurants. The town is known for its vibrant community and friendly atmosphere, making it a popular destination for both residents and visitors. The downtown area is also home to the historic train station, which is a reminder of Madison’s past as a bustling railroad town.

In addition to its charming downtown, Madison is also home to a number of beautiful parks and outdoor spaces. The town’s location in the lush green landscape of Morris County provides ample opportunities for outdoor recreation and leisure. The Madison Recreation Complex, which includes sports fields, playgrounds, and walking trails, is a popular spot for locals to gather and enjoy the outdoors. Residents and visitors alike can also enjoy the serene beauty of the Great Swamp National Wildlife Refuge, which is situated just a short drive from Madison.

Madison is also steeped in history, with many well-preserved historic sites and landmarks. The town’s rich past is evident in its beautifully restored Victorian homes, as well as in its numerous museums and historical sites. The Museum of Early Trades and Crafts, for example, offers a glimpse into the town’s early industrial history and showcases the skills and trades of the craftsmen who shaped Madison’s development.

Overall, Madison, New Jersey is a vibrant and welcoming community with a rich history and an abundance of natural beauty. Its charming downtown, beautiful parks, and historic landmarks make it a wonderful place to live or visit. With its small-town feel and convenient location, Madison is truly a gem in the Garden State.
